Board of Mayor & Aldermen
The Board approved several rezoning ordinances, a revised city travel policy, and a land sale in the North Industrial Park. They also authorized budget amendments, utility rate adjustments, and the purchase of two police vehicles.
- Approved sale of 15.3 acres in North Industrial Park to Aigremont of Belgium for $431,040 (7-0)
- Approved Ordinance 22-20 revising the city travel policy (7-0)
- Approved Ordinance 22-21 rezoning parcels on South Main Street and Batts Boulevard to Core Commercial District (7-0)
- Approved Ordinance 22-22 rezoning parcels on 15th Avenue West, Bransford Drive, and John L. Patterson Street to High Density Residential District (7-0)
- Approved Ordinance 22-23 amending the FY2023 annual budget on first reading (7-0)
- Approved Ordinance 22-24 rezoning a parcel on Tom Austin Highway to Commercial Services District on first reading (7-0)
- Approved $103,129 purchase of two 2023 Dodge Durango police vehicles (7-0)
- Approved $630,000 Community Development Block Grant Contract for Water/Wastewater Department (7-0)
Airport Board
The Board voted to terminate the site design contract with Klober Engineering Services and approved the sale of surplus equipment. Members also established permanent base pay levels for two employees and elected board officers for the new calendar year.
- Approved November 2022 meeting minutes (unanimous)
- Approved November 2022 Treasurer's report (unanimous)
- Approved sale of surplus mowers and dishwasher via govdeals.com (unanimous)
- Approved termination of Klober Engineering Services contract (unanimous)
- Approved making interim pay for Lynn West and Jenni Omer permanent through Dec 31, 2023 (unanimous)
- Elected Paul Nutting as Chairman (6-0)
- Elected Lewis Walling as Vice Chairman (unanimous)
- Elected Edison Guthrie as Secretary-Treasurer (unanimous)

Airport Board
The board approved funding requests to the Tennessee Aeronautics Division for a fuel farm relocation and T-hangar site preparation. It also authorized the use of grant funds for hangar floor repairs and approved the employment terms for a new airport manager.
- Approved funding request for fuel farm relocation and apron expansion final design and bid (Unanimous)
- Approved funding request for T-hangar project site preparation preliminary design and environmental study using BIL money (Unanimous)
- Approved October 2022 Treasurer's report showing $275,650.02 in accounts (Unanimous)
- Authorized creation of a surplus equipment list for sale via govdeals.com (Unanimous)
- Recommended Paul Nutting and Gina Holt for appointment to new board terms (Unanimous)
- Approved using remaining Hangar Renovation grant funds to replace the floor in the Highland Rim Aviation hangar (Unanimous)
- Approved $75,000 salary and a $500 monthly health insurance stipend for six months for new manager Brian Urbach (Unanimous)
- Approved meeting minutes from October 12, 17, and 24, 2022 (Unanimous)
Board of Zoning Appeals
The Board of Zoning Appeals approved a 23-foot front building setback variance for Chemtrade Inc. at 1801 W. Hillcrest Dr. to allow for an office and minimal parking. The approval includes a condition that landscaping be added along the 17th Avenue property line as a buffer.
- Approved August 9, 2022 meeting minutes (all in favor)
- Approved 23’ front building setback variance for 1801 W. Hillcrest Dr. with landscaping condition (3-0)
Planning Commission
The Planning Commission approved three rezoning requests to allow for residential row homes and neighborhood conformity. The board also approved a liquor store request for One Stop Market and the naming of a new road for E911 safety.
- Approved rezone of 15th Ave W and Bransford Dr from CLS to R7 (7-0)
- Approved rezone of 1320 S. Main St. from CS to CC for row homes (7-0)
- Approved rezone of Batts Blvd from MRO/CS to CC (7-0)
- Approved liquor store request at One Stop Market, 2018 S. Main St. (7-0)
- Approved naming of Delight Court between Industrial Dr. and Electrolux Dr. (7-0)
- Approved September 1, 2022 meeting minutes (all in favor)
